Two types of E-Transmittals are which?

Explanation:
In OIMS, Electronic Transmittals are used to move important administrative actions between agencies, and they come in two main forms that cover where a person lives and travel outside the country. The first form, county of residence transmittal, documents the offender’s residential jurisdiction. This is important because supervision, reporting requirements, and access to local resources are tied to the county where the person lives. The second form, a request out of country travel permit, handles international travel. It ensures there’s an approved, documented process before the offender can travel abroad, with coordination and risk checks as needed. Other options mix or omit these specific functions, such as focusing on domestic or in-state travel without addressing jurisdictional residency, or using a county of origin transmittal which isn’t the commonly used category here. The pairing that fits the system’s typical categories is county of residence transmittal alongside a request out of country travel permit.
